Migration step 7: Brightforge CI now builds Lanternware under the hermetic toolchain. No network during build. All deps come from the pinned vendor snapshot; if a fetch sneaks in, the sandbox kills the job. After the hermetic build passes, promote the artifact to the staging channel via the relay tool. Promotion requires signing; do not reuse old Forgeline keys — they were revoked last quarter. Use the current release signing key, which follows below.

deploy key for kajof-yawif: bky9_fvxrpdHPq

The Parcelwing webhook dispatches a POST to your registered endpoint whenever a shipment status changes in the Drayline network. Payloads include the tracking token, carrier leg, and timestamp, signed with an HMAC header. Retries follow exponential backoff for up to six attempts. To authenticate callbacks against the internal verifier, use the key below.

app token of yajeg-kawef = kto11_7En3XSX8xQw

## Configuration

The flaky integration tests in Paylark mostly stem from the sandbox gateway throttling unauthenticated retries. To run the suite reliably, copy `.env.test.example` to `.env.test` and fill in the gateway settings. Set `PAYLARK_GATEWAY_HOST` to the sandbox host and `PAYLARK_RETRY_MAX=2`. The tests will still fail without a valid gateway credential, so on the very next line add it.

env line for yahip-tafog: RELAY_SECRET3=4ca

## Account Recovery — Trailnote Offline Mode

When a surveyor's Trailnote app has been offline for 30+ days, their local credentials expire and sync refuses to resume. Don't make them wipe the device — all their unsynced field data lives there! Instead, open the support console, pick "Offline Reinstate," and enter their handle. The console will ask for the support team's shared recovery passphrase before issuing a reinstatement token. Use the one below.

unlock words, bagaf-fajeg: zorael-kelax-fraath-quenix-eliok-sileth-aldmir-wenir-druiel